Your town can choose to give bigger property tax breaks to senior homeowners. It creates $1,000 income steps below the town’s maximum income limit (M) for the senior exemption. Exemptions of your home’s assessed value are: under M but over M-$1,000: 50%; under M-$1,000 but over M-$2,000: 55%; under M-$2,000 but over M-$3,000: 60%; under M-$3,000: 65%. You must be 65 or older and have income below M. Beginning January 1, 2026, these larger exemptions apply only where the local government adopts this option.
